As a State -certified Midwife at CMC NDR, you will ensure complete monitoring of pregnancies, at all stages. your missions will be as follows:

 




 

  • Ensure medical monitoring of pregnant women and monitor the smooth progress of the pregnancy through prenatal medical examinations, scheduled regularly until the birth of the child;
  • Lead childbirth preparation sessions;
  • Provide preventive advisors and educate  the future mother on postnatal care, breastfeeding or baby hygiene.
  • Carry out deliveries, most of the time alone; carefully monitor the progress of “labor” from start to finish and call the obstetrician-gynecologist or surgeon in the event of risks or complications.
  • Examine the newborn immediately after birth, checking reflexes and monitoring health. In the few days following delivery,
  • Ensure medical follow-up by transmitting information to the team and in each woman’s file.
  •   Ensure medical monitoring of the infant and also monitor the health of the mother and her good recovery In the few days following delivery.
  • Organize, supervise and lead prevention and education actions for mothers and children (PMI).
  • Supervise and train other healthcare personnel (nurses and trainees)
  • Learn about and train on new practices in Midwifery

  1. Midwife/Midwife Skills State Qualified SF300-DSS-CMC NDR

 

v   Medical and health skills 

 

 

 

  • Prepare the woman for delivery and monitor fetal heart rate, cervical dilation, clinical status, etc.
  • Carry out the delivery or provide technical support to the obstetrician.
  • Perform postpartum care and birth examination of the newborn.
  • Advise the mother on the first maternal gestures.
  • Inform and advise women in specific situations.
  • Monitor an infant’s health and development and intervene if necessary.
  • Lead childbirth or parenthood preparation sessions.
  • Ensure gynecological monitoring of women of all ages, excluding pregnancy.
  • Prescribe contraception.
  • Carry out medical examinations (obstetric ultrasound, biological samples, blood tests, smears, etc.).
